Proposition 19 creates particular challenges for Arcadia families with high-value homes. If your parents purchased their home for $400,000 in 1990 and it's now worth $2.5 million, the property tax could jump from $6,000 to $31,000 annually without proper planning. As a Los Angeles County city, Arcadia estates go through probate at Stanley Mosk Courthouse downtown. For a $3 million estate, statutory probate fees exceed $78,000—money that should go to your family. The cornerstone of your estate plan. Avoids probate, maintains privacy, and gives you full control during your lifetime. Easily amendable as your circumstances change.
Catches any assets not transferred to your trust during your lifetime. Ensures everything ends up where it belongs, with your trust as the ultimate destination.
Designates someone to manage your finances if you become incapacitated. Avoids the need for a conservatorship proceeding.
Specifies your medical treatment wishes and names someone to make healthcare decisions on your behalf if needed.
